Every morning, I walk past two empty bedrooms and say a quick prayer for Ellie and William, both away at college. My youngest Leah is still home, but with fourteen-hour days of high school practices and rehearsals, the house gets quiet in ways I didn’t expect.

My husband and I aren’t officially empty nesters yet, but sometimes it feels like it.

What I’ve come to know is the particular tension of holding opposite emotions at the same time. Grief at missing my daily connection with my teens, alongside pride as I watch them live independently. Fear about how they’ll manage their mental health and the everyday tasks of adult life, alongside hope that their support systems will carry them. Joy when they come home for a break and, if I’m honest, some overwhelm when suddenly there’s no car for me to use and the kitchen looks like a train wreck.

And when you add in the nuances of parenting neurodiverse teens - kids who may need more alone time, or more support, or both depending on the day - it gets even more complicated.

If any of that resonates with you, I want you to know you’re not alone.
